Transaction 78e43c663f80531063c7fbd0d480432ee38c63fef055e44526da0b3a111e812f
1 Input
2 Outputs
- 78e43c663f80531063c7fbd0d480432ee38c63fef055e44526da0b3a111e812f:0
- 78e43c663f80531063c7fbd0d480432ee38c63fef055e44526da0b3a111e812f:1
value 418952
address 39aCiy2ASZaLwVYoUR7877oM5CQXimNorX
value 233494172
address 17rdsoRKFWurXwekYabxtWcpWi6LnxYtmg